Discover the History of Koreshan State Park

If you’re interested in history, be sure to visit Koreshan State Park. This unique park was once the site of a utopian community that believed in celibacy and vegetarianism. Today, visitors can explore the historic buildings, learn about the group’s beliefs and practices, and enjoy the beautiful natural surroundings.

Discover the Beauty of Estero Bay Preserve State Park

For nature lovers, Estero Bay Preserve State Park is a must-visit destination. This beautiful park features mangrove forests, saltwater marshes, and a variety of wildlife. Visitors can explore the area by canoe or kayak, hike through the trails, or simply relax and enjoy the stunning views.
